Output ff762c7f535963fc84552fa13fabdf6d61726efd222975678d12916b2401c82d:1

value
8398377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f150e6a0beb2a1e8a81c0ece91c8b10a34fbe0 OP_EQUAL
address
3BMBxcjW63bwNjfBsWb1wBZiq8NaiN7da1
transaction
ff762c7f535963fc84552fa13fabdf6d61726efd222975678d12916b2401c82d
confirmations
324384
spent
true